      Meaning of the first name Wendalyn

      Origin

      English, possibly American.

      Meaning

      A blend of "Wend" meaning to travel and "lyn" meaning lake or waterfall.

      Variations

      Gwendalyn, Wendolyn, Wendaline
      The name Wendalyn is a modern feminine given name that is believed to be derived from the name Wendell, which itself has Germanic roots. The etymology of Wendell can be traced back to the Old High German word "winda," meaning "to wander" or "to travel." The addition of the suffix "-lyn" has become a common trend in contemporary naming practices, creating names that evoke a softer, more delicate sound. This synthesis results in Wendalyn, which can be interpreted as "a wanderer" or "one who travels," although specific meanings tied directly to the name Wendalyn itself are not well documented.

      Based on our records...

      Mckinney

      This is the most common surname associated with Wendalyn.

      Andrew

      This is the most common name of those married to a Wendalyn.

      Alexandra

      This is the most common name for a child of a Wendalyn.
